The Buccaneers are reportedly still talking to Brown's representatives, per ESPN, which means a reunion with the defending Super Bowl champions isn't out of the question. Brown still sees that possibility, saying, "Me and Playoff Lenny (Leonard Fournette) gonna work this out," when a fan wrote that Brown needed to return to Tampa Bay.
The 49ers' division rivals, the Seattle Seahawks, could also be a possibility. They have reportedly expressed interest in the veteran wideout.
Brown was active for eight games last season and caught 45 passes for 483 yards and four touchdowns. Brown was suspended for eight games in 2020 for multiple violations of the NFL's personal conduct policy. According to NFL.com, his suspension stemmed from his no-contest plea to burglary and battery charges from an incident in Florida last year and accusations that he sent intimidating texts to a woman who accused Brown of making past unwanted advances toward her.
Brown has caught 886 passes for 11,746 yards and 79 touchdowns during his 11 NFL seasons. He is a seven-time Pro Bowl selection.
